Dear Mr. and Mrs. Aamodt:
This letter is to confirm earlier information provided to you ve-bally regarding the results of environmental sample analyses. Specifically, radio-isotopic analyses of several soil / water saaples have been conducted. Two samples were collected during the August 30, 1984 trip with you to three locations on the West shore of the Susquehanna river in the vicinity of the Three Mile Island site. These locations, per your request, are not further identified in this letter. One soil sample (Loca ion #1) was collected by representatives of the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) on Septemb2r 4, 1984.
The results of the analyses completed to date indicate that the samples contained plutoniuc, strontium, and cesium at levels associated with fallout from weapons testing, in addition to naturally occurring radioisotopes. These results are consistent with those that were obtained August 30, 1904 by representatives of the Nuclear Regulatory Coamission (NRC), the EPA and the Pennsylvania Departret of Environmental Resources (PA DER) using portable radiation monitoring instruments. The information presented in this letter has been reviewed and concurmd in by EPA and PA DER officials.
The enclosure provides preser.uf available results of the analyses Ltich have been performed by HRC, DOE, EPA's Middletown Field Office and by the PA DER's laboratory. Additional analysis of the samples at EPA's Montgomery, Alcbana, laboratory is scheduled to be completed within a few weeks. The results of these tests will be provided to you when they become available.

ENCLOSURE Nature of Radioisotope Location Sample Radioisotope Concentration (pCi/c)*
1 Soil Cesium-137 0.52 0.023 2
Soil Cesium-137 1.011 0.025 Strontium-90 0.09 2 0.05 Plutonium-239/240 0.00 0.002 Pond Water Spring Water 3
Soil Cesium-137 0.59 0.024
- pCi/g = picocuries per gram = billionths of a curie per gram.
- The pond and spring water samples were analyzed by PA DER and EPA. With the exception of naturally occurring radionuclides, no activity above the mini-mum detectable concentration was found. The minimum detectable concentra-tion is in the range of a few picocuries per milliliter (one milliliter of water is approximately I gram).
NOTE: Except at location 2, analyses for strontium and transuranics have not yet been completed.
Results of these analyses will be provided when they become available from the EPA.
